## 2.9.0 — Changed defaults: per-tenant rate quotas

Gatewick now enforces per-tenant rate quotas by default rather than the shared global limit. Existing tenants were migrated to the standard tier automatically; tenants previously on custom overrides are unaffected. On-call: expect a brief rise in 429 responses for a handful of heavy tenants during the first week. The new default quota configuration is shown below.

deployment values, fajog-bajeg:
[oliix]
port = 3306
region = lower-3
host = oliix.zemvarworks.corp
timeout_ms = 1500
retries = 3

Ticket: SPLITWISE-ENV misconfig on staging

Hey Dara — quick one before the cut. The Bramblefork assignment service on staging is still pointing at the old Petrel cluster, so roughly a third of users are getting bucketed into experiments that were archived last sprint. Metrics look wild but it's just stale config, not a real regression. I've fixed the cluster URL and the bucket salt in staging.env already. The only thing left is the service's auth token for the assignment store, which goes right after this line.

env line for yahip-tafog: RELAY_SECRET3=4ca

## Order Cutoff Limits

Crumbline enforces a daily cutoff so the Ovenworks scheduler can lock tomorrow's bake plan. Orders placed after cutoff roll to the next available production day automatically; customers see this at checkout, so do not manually override it in the admin panel. Holiday calendars shift the cutoff earlier, and wholesale accounts get a separate, stricter window because their dough proofing starts overnight. Grace periods exist only for edits, not new orders. The constants governing all of this are below.

limits module of fajog-tawig:
RATE_LIMITS = {
    "druwyn": 2,
    "quenael": 10,
    "wenix": 2,
    "druael": 2,
}